
Alex Brown
DOB: 30th September 1992
Position: Midfielder
Season of first appearance: 2018/19
Season of last appearance: 2018/19
Full Appearances: 8
Substitute: 0
Goals: 2
Also played for:
Gillingham, Corby Town, Maidstone United, Leatherhead, Dartford, Hythe Town, Ashford United
Player Profile:
Midfielder Alex came through the ranks at Gillingham, signing his first professional contract in summer 2011. In September 2011, he went on loan to Isthmian South outfit Whitstable Town.
On the last day of 2011-12, he made his first-team debut for Gillingham as a sub in a 2-0 League Two home win against Morecambe on 5.5.12.
In October 2012, he went on loan to Corby Town of Conference North with fellow Gills and future Margate player Jack Evans. In December 2012, Alex was sent on another loan, this time to Maidstone United.
Alex was made available for a free transfer in January 2013 by Gillingham and subsequently signed permanently for the Stones. He won two promotions with Maidstone and scored a stunning 20-yard goal in a 2-1 home win over Margate on 28.3.15.
He went on loan to Leatherhead in December 2015 and made the move permanent in January 2016 but at the end of the 2015-16 season left the Tanners.
In summer 2016, Alex joined National League South side Dartford. He stayed with the Darts until the end of the 2017–18 campaign.
Alex signed for Margate in summer 2018 and scored twice on his league debut in a 5-2 home win over Corinthian Casuals on 11.8.18.
Alex’s last match for the club was an FA Cup tie at home to Horndean on 8.9.18, a match Margate won 3-2. In the first half he had to go off with a serious knee injury that kept him out of action for the rest of the season.
Alex was released by Margate and made a comeback from injury with Hythe Town during 2019-20. He stayed at Reachfields until the end of the 2021-22 campaign, when he moved to Ashford United.
